
Red Hat Enterprise Linux 7(简称RHEL7)作为企业级Linux发行版,以其稳定性和强大的性能赢得了广泛的认可
然而,在VMware下安装RHEL7并非简单的点击几下鼠标就能完成的任务,其中涉及多个关键步骤和注意事项
本文将详细解析在VMware下安装RHEL7的注意点,确保您能够顺利完成安装并优化系统性能
一、准备工作 1.软件版本兼容性 在安装之前,确保您的VMware Workstation版本稳定且与RHEL7兼容
通常推荐使用最新稳定版本的VMware Workstation,如VMware Workstation 14或15
同时,您需要准备好RHEL7的ISO镜像文件,这是安装的基础
请从官方渠道下载ISO镜像文件,以确保文件的完整性和安全性
2.物理机配置要求 物理机的配置直接影响到虚拟机的性能
确保您的物理机满足以下要求: - 64位系统,并开启虚拟化技术(如Intel VT-x或AMD-V)
- 至少2GB内存空间,但建议物理机内存至少为4GB,以便为虚拟机分配足够的内存
- 足够的硬盘空间用于存储虚拟机文件和虚拟磁盘
- 退出或卸载可能影响虚拟机性能的安全软件,如电脑管家、360等
二、创建虚拟机 1.选择自定义安装 在VMware中新建虚拟机时,建议选择“自定义(高级)”选项,以便根据个人需求进行细致的配置
这有助于优化虚拟机的性能,并避免不必要的资源浪费
2.设置虚拟机兼容性 选择虚拟机硬件兼容性时,建议选择与您安装的VMware Workstation版本相匹配的选项
这可以确保虚拟机在VMware环境中获得最佳的性能支持
3.稍后安装操作系统 在安装客户机操作系统时,选择“稍后安装操作系统”
这样,您可以在后续步骤中手动加载RHEL7的ISO镜像文件,以便按照安装向导的指示完成安装
三、虚拟机配置 1.命名与位置 为虚拟机命名时,建议包含版本和系统信息,如“RHEL7_64bit”
同时,选择一个空间较大的分区作为虚拟机的存储位置,避免安装在Windows的C盘,以免影响性能
2.处理器配置 处理器配置保持默认即可,但需注意不要超过实际CPU核心数
否则,可能会导致性能瓶颈
如果您的物理机CPU具有多核心,可以为虚拟机分配适量的核心数,以提高处理性能
3.内存设置 虚拟机内存设置需合理,不应超过物理机实际内存的一半
推荐使用默认值,但可以根据实际需求进行调整
内存分配过多可能导致物理机性能下降,而分配过少则可能影响虚拟机运行效率
4.网络类型选择 网络类型对虚拟机的网络通信至关重要
常见的选项包括桥接网络、NAT和仅主机网络
对于学习和测试环境,NAT模式是一个不错的选择
它可以自动获取网络配置,使虚拟机能够访问外部网络
四、磁盘与虚拟磁盘配置 1.创建新虚拟磁盘 在创建虚拟磁盘时,默认大小通常足够使用
选择单个文件存储可以方便管理
磁盘类型选择默认设置即可,这通常适用于VMware所支持的格式
2.磁盘容量规划 磁盘容量应根据实际需求进行调整
虽然默认20GB的磁盘容量通常够用,但对于需要安装大量软件或存储大量数据的虚拟机,可能需要更大的磁盘空间
请注意,不要选择立即分配所有磁盘空间,而是选择按需分配,以节省磁盘资源
五、安装步骤与注意事项 1.加载ISO镜像文件 在启动虚拟机之前,需要加载RHEL7的ISO镜像文件
在虚拟机的CD/DVD驱动器设置中,选择“使用ISO映像文件”,并指定ISO文件的存放路径
2.选择安装类型 在安装过程中,您可以选择最小化安装(仅包含命令行界面)或带有图形化用户界面(GUI)的服务器安装
根据您的需求选择合适的安装类型
3.设置root密码 安装过程中需要设置root密码
请确保密码的复杂度符合要求,以避免安全风险
如果密码不符合要求,可以选择强制设置
但请注意,过于简单的密码可能会降低系统安全性
4.分区与磁盘划分 在安装位置选择中,您可以选择自动配置分区或手动进行分区
对于初学者来说,自动配置分区是一个简单的选择
但如果您需要更精细地管理磁盘空间,可以选择手动分区
5.安装额外软件 在安装过程中,您还可以选择安装额外的软件包
这些软件包可能包括开发工具、数据库服务器、Web服务器等
根据您的需求选择合适的软件包进行安装
六、远程连接与管理 1.查看虚拟机IP地址 安装完成后,您需要使用远程连接工具(如Xshell)连接到虚拟机
首先,通过`ifconfig`命令查看虚拟机的IP地址
2.配置远程连接 在Xshell中新建会话,并设置会话名称、主机IP地址、用户身份验证等信息
填写root用户名和密码后,即可建立远程连接
3.优化远程连接性能 为了提高远程连接的性能,您可以调整虚拟机的网络设置、优化系统配置等
例如,可以关闭不必要的服务、调整网络带宽限制等
七、常见问题与解决方案 1.ISO镜像文件损坏 如果在安装过程中遇到问题,首先检查ISO镜像文件的完整性
您可以使用校验和工具(如MD5或SHA256)来验证ISO文件的完整性
2.虚拟机性能瓶颈 如果虚拟机运行缓慢或出现性能瓶颈,请检查处理器配置、内存分配、磁盘I/O等方面
确保虚拟机配置合理且资源分配充足
3.网络连接问题 如果虚拟机无法访问外部网络,请检查网络类型设置、NAT配置、防火墙规则等
确保网络连接配置正确且防火墙允许虚拟机访问外部网络
4.许可证密钥问题 如果在安装完成后出现许可证密钥问题导致无法正常开启虚拟机,请按照提示依次输入相应的密钥或选择试用版本
同时,确保您使用的VMware Workstation版本与RHEL7兼容
八、总结与优化建议 1.定期更新系统 为了保持系统的安全性和稳定性,请定期更新系统和软件包
您可以使用`yum`命令来更新系统和软件包
2.备份重要数据 定期备份虚拟机中的重要数据以防止数据丢失
您可以使用VMware的快照功能或第三方备份工具来进行数据备份
3.优化系统性能 根据您的需求优化系统性能
例如,可以关闭不必要的服务、调整系统参数、优化磁盘I/O等
这些优化措施可以提高虚拟机的运行效率和响应速度
4.学习与实践 最后,鼓励您不断学习与实践VMware和RHEL7的相关知识
通过实践来加深对虚拟化技术和Linux操作系统的理解,并不断提升自己的技能水平
总之,在VMware下安装RHEL7需要注意多个关键点,包括准备工作、虚拟机创建与配置、安装步骤与注意事项以及远程连接与管理等
通过遵循本文的指南和建议,您可以顺利完成安装并优化系统性能
同时,不断学习与实践将有助于您更好地掌握虚拟化技术和Linux操作系统的相关知识
VMware 15 USB设备查看指南
VMware安装RHEL7必备注意事项
VMware上轻松安装kaiLinux指南
Kali2安装VMware Tools教程
TeamViewer键盘失灵,远程操作怎么办?
TeamViewer远程操控,个性壁纸随心换
TeamViewer操作小贴士:为何需刷新界面才能恢复正常使用?
VMware 15 USB设备查看指南
VMware上轻松安装kaiLinux指南
Kali2安装VMware Tools教程
VMware虚拟机搭建软路由指南
VMware虚拟机命令行启动指南
VMware ESXi 许可证全解析
VMware配置:如何关闭文件夹共享
VMware:从起源到今日的虚拟化巨头
EMC VMware备份优化实战指南
卸载VMware,保留重要数据与设置
VMware开机添加硬盘教程
VMware支持的两种克隆类型解析